Uemut uin.

Absolutely, of course.

Niaut!

Goodbye!

Iame uenapissish!

See you soon!

Tshekuan etutamin?

What are you doing?

Nakatuenimitishu! Ma minuat tshika uapamitunan.

Take care! We'll see each other another time.

Ekᵘ, tshiminuaten a?

So, do you enjoy it?

Eshkᵘ nitshishkutamakaun innu-aimun.

I'm taking Innu language classes again.

Miam a nuitsheuakan?

Doing well, my friend?

Niminupan, tshinashkumitin.

I'm well, thanks.

Ekᵘ tshin, tan eshpanin?

And you, how are you?

Apu tshekuan tutaman.

I'm not doing anything special.

Eukuan miam!

Okay, great!

Eukuan!

I see!

Kuei nuitsheuakan! Eshe miam.

Hello my friend! Yes [I'm] fine.
